Steven Gerrard finally broke his silence on the Douglas Luiz contract situation at Aston Villa. He said that the club is yet to receive any transfer offer from other clubs for the Brazilian. However, Luiz only has 11 months left on his current contract at the Midlands club. But he seems content with how the flow of play is going on.

According to the up to date reports, the Serie A champions AC Milan want to lure him away from the Premier League club. Previously, reports also linked another Italian club AS Roma and Arsenal to Luiz as keen parties to sign him.

Reporters asked Villa manager Steven Gerrard about the contract dilemma with Douglas Luiz. Others asked if he could be a long-term player for Villa in years to come. Gerrard replied:

“He’s playing well, he’s working hard. We totally respect Douglas’s situation, I love him as a player.”

“He’s been absolutely fine and professional. There are no issues from me. We’ll play that one by ear week to week. But, yeah, there’s nothing really to say because we haven’t had an offer and, at the moment, he’s got a year left. He’s been professional, he’s smiling and he’s enjoying it and we roll forward.”

Earlier this year many reports coming from Brazil mentioned that he hired Kia Joorabchian and Guiliano Bertolucci as his new agents. This agent pair also represents a couple of other Villa players in the form of Philippe Coutinho and Diego Carlos.

Douglas Luiz played all three pre-season games for Villa and looks like Gerrard wants him to make an integral part of the team. While asked about transfer activities of Villa, Steven Gerrard replied:

“We’ll see what the next weeks bring. But, yeah, in an ideal world we’ve got an eye on the market and, if something comes up that suits us, I’ll speak to people that concerns.”
